Apple is a Computers and Electronics Manufacturing company headquartered in Cupertino, United States , founded in 1976 (NASDAQ: AAPL).

- Apple unveils next generation of Apple Intelligence, Siri AI, and more
At WWDC 2026, Apple previewed the next generation of Apple Intelligence and a more personalized Siri, alongside updates across iOS, macOS (Golden Gate) and its core apps.
- Tim Cook to become Executive Chairman, John Ternus to become CEO
Apple announced that John Ternus, SVP of Hardware Engineering, will become CEO on September 1, 2026, with Tim Cook moving to Executive Chairman of the board.
- Apple reports fourth quarter and record fiscal 2025 results
Apple capped a record fiscal year with full-year revenue of $416 billion, up from $391 billion the prior year.
